| Introduction | Elsie Grant writes historical romantic fiction set in the early nineteenth century. |
|---|---|
| Interests | Elsie's first novel, “An Independent Heart”, was published in March 2020. She is currently working on her second novel, which revolves around a bright young heiress and a one-armed sea-captain and is partly set in Greece. Apart from writing and reading, Elsie enjoys knitting, cooking, gardening or just being in the garden, watching the plants grow and listening to the birds sing; sailing, skiing, walking and cycling. |
